How to use Midnight Tea Ceremony

Overview

The Midnight Tea Ceremony palette embodies serenity and refinement, drawing inspiration from the quiet solemnity of a dusk tea ceremony. This collection of dark teals and muted grays, including the grounding #1E3231 and the delicate #A7B9B8, creates a sophisticated and calming atmosphere. The subtle variations, such as #3F5453 and #627877, allow for depth and warmth, making it ideal for minimalist designs, wellness platforms, or any project seeking a tranquil and elegant aesthetic.

Suggested color roles

primary

Use #1E3231 as the deep, calming background, setting a tranquil and sophisticated tone for the entire design.

secondary

Apply #2B3D3C for subtle borders, secondary content blocks, or navigational elements to add gentle structure.

accent

Highlight interactive elements, delicate details, or key information with #A7B9B8, providing a soft, refined focal point.

background

Employ #1E3231 as the primary canvas for a serene and elegant dark teal/grey theme.

text

For optimal legibility on dark backgrounds, use #A7B9B8 for primary text. #627877 can be used for secondary text or captions, ensuring a gentle contrast.

Accessibility notes

  • Ensure #A7B9B8 provides sufficient contrast against #1E3231 for all text to meet WCAG AA standards.
  • Avoid using #2B3D3C or #3F5453 for small text on the darkest backgrounds, as readability may be poor.
  • For interactive elements, ensure the accent color offers clear visual feedback and sufficient contrast.
  • Consider larger font sizes or bolder weights when using #627877 for text on darker backgrounds.
